Cybersecurity: The Critical Imperative for DC Nonprofits and Associations
Washington DC nonprofits and associations hold data that cybercriminals actively seek. Donor records, member information, government grant data, financial systems, and advocacy materials all represent high-value targets.
As organizations become more digitally connected and reliant on third-party technologies, external data sources, and outside service providers, they are more exposed to direct cyberattacks and more vulnerable to the financial, operational, and reputational consequences of an attack on a vendor or partner. At the same time, cybercriminals are becoming more sophisticated with the assistance of artificial intelligence, leading to more frequent attacks that are harder to prevent.
Nonprofit organizations, which typically have lower budgets and fewer cybersecurity defenses, are particularly at risk. The assumption that nonprofits fly below the radar of sophisticated attackers is no longer accurate. A breach that exposes donor information or disrupts program operations carries consequences that extend far beyond the immediate incident.

Compliance Considerations for Washington DC Organizations
Few markets carry a heavier compliance burden than Washington DC. Organizations receiving federal funding, handling protected health information (PHI), or working adjacent to government agencies must navigate frameworks including HIPAA, NIST, CMMC, and evolving OMB guidelines.
Organizations that are recipients or subrecipients of U.S. government funds are now subject to stricter cybersecurity guidelines released by the Office of Management and Budget. Failure to implement reasonable cybersecurity measures not only exposes organizations to increased cybersecurity risks but also jeopardizes their eligibility for federal funding.
These requirements demand that IT infrastructure be designed with compliance in mind from the ground up. IT Support Across Key DC-Area Verticals
Washington DC's organizational landscape is diverse, and managed IT needs vary meaningfully across sectors. The following table outlines key IT priorities for common DC-area organization types.
Organization Type | Primary IT Priorities | Key Compliance Frameworks |
Nonprofit | Donor data protection, budget-aligned services, remote workforce support | HIPAA (if health-related), OMB cybersecurity guidelines |
Trade Association | Member data security, event technology, scalable cloud infrastructure | State data privacy laws, PCI DSS (if payment processing) |
Healthcare Organization | PHI protection, telehealth infrastructure, clinical workflow continuity | HIPAA, HITECH |
Government Contractor | NIST compliance, secure access controls, documentation support | CMMC, NIST 800-171, DFARS |
Financial Services Firm | Data governance, ransomware resilience, regulatory reporting | SEC, FINRA, SOX |
